WHAT YOU WILL DO

  • Support and report to the Senior Group Manager, Corporate Planning in advancing HMNA’s mid-to-long-term business planning, corporate strategy, and cross-functional strategic initiatives.
  • Translate market trends, strategic initiatives, and executive vision into actionable business insights and all corporate planning activities to ensure Hyundai and Genesis Motor North America achieve short- and long-term objectives.
  • Provide analysis and project management support to help ensure key initiatives are developed, aligned, and executed effectively across relevant stakeholders.

HOW YOU WILL MAKE AN IMPACT

  • Perform detailed analysis, research, and coordination to support annual, mid-term, and long-term corporate planning activities, aligning priorities across business units, regions, and global headquarters.
  • Develop and maintain planning inputs, assumptions, scenario models, KPI materials, investment prioritization analyses, forecasting, and related planning processes.
  • Work with regional and functional teams to gather data, validate assumptions, reconcile inputs, track deliverables, and translate priorities into consolidated planning materials.
  • Execute Corporate Planning initiatives, including process mapping, issue identification, timeline tracking, stakeholder follow-up, documentation, and implementation support.
  • Conduct market, operational, and financial analysis to support Hyundai and Genesis initiatives, competitive strategies, and resource allocation efforts.
  • Manage multiple strategic workstreams by organizing project plans, tracking milestones, monitoring risks, and ensuring timely completion of deliverables.
  • Serve as a liaison across functions and regions, including the U.S., Canada, and Mexico, to gather inputs, resolve open items, and maintain alignment.
  • Cook up with stakeholders to prepare meeting materials, capture decisions, follow up on action items, and support initiative execution.
  • Research and analyze automotive trends, emerging technologies, regulatory developments, consumer shifts, and competitor activity.
  • Develop research summaries, competitive assessments, opportunity scans, and risk analyses to support planning and investment decisions.
  • Develop executive-ready analyses, strategic presentations, business cases, KPI dashboards, and briefing materials for senior leadership.
  • Independently explore strategic opportunities, manage resources, support partner outreach, develop proposals including timelines, budgets, and KPIs, and manage multiple initiatives.

WHAT HYUNDAI CAN OFFER YOU

  • Monthly Hyundai/Genesis vehicle lease allowance (including insurance and maintenance).
  • Holiday Pay - the company shuts down with pay between Christmas and New Years.
  • Medical, dental, and vision insurance for you and your family, with employer contributions to Health Savings Accounts.
  • 401(k) retirement plan with Employer Match.
  • Additional 401(K) Employer Enhanced Contribution program – eligible after 1 year of employment, in addition to the regular employer matching contribution.
  • Vacation and sick time off.
  • Employer-paid basic life and disability coverage, including Paid-Family Leave.
  • Mental health, wellbeing, and employee assistance program.
  • Health advocate (support).
  • Education Reimbursement program: Up to $5,250 per year for employees seeking higher education degrees.
  • External Training and Development Programs.
  • Compensation Range: $114,800.00 - $164,000.00 annual base salary.
